Property Manager / Building Superintendent
We are seeking a Property Manager/ Commercial Building Superintendent to oversee, manage and maintain two Commercial/Industrial buildings located in east Toronto (Leslieville and Victoria Park/Eglington areas).
We are looking for a person who can both do the business /administrative side of the management as well as strap a tool belt on to maintain the properties including minor repairs, some drywall, painting etc.
This is a full-time role paying $60,000 to $70,000 annually plus full benefits and 14 personal days first year.
Responsibilities:
- You act as the right-hand person to the President / Owner.
- You are the key person in the operation of two commercial/industrial buildings.
- 25-35% administrative role including executing leases, maintaining tenant documents (e.g. insurance, parking, etc), documenting all renovations and repairs, corresponding with tenants, and all other administrative duties required by the building owner.
- Answering and dealing with calls from tenants, prospective tenants and real estate agents; and, responding to and liaising with clients/tenants, real estate firms, vendors, contractors and other stakeholders.
- Prepare a weekly report and review with owner, any issues and their status, and proactively make suggestions on how to improve the property and service provided to Tenants.
- Build solid relationships with tenants to make them feel part of the family. You are the go-to person for all tenant communication, to-do’s, complaints, and requests.
- Work with realtors to get empty units rented.
- Prepare the unit, take calls, open units for viewings and do showings of vacant units.
- Schedule move-in/move-out with tenants and ensure all documents are in order.
- Perform routine daily/regular site inspections, maintain the property to ensure building standards and check for any issues.
- Perform minor repairs, make sure the building and parking lots are clean and tidy and ensure buildings are safe and secure.
- Where larger repairs or maintenance is required, you are to get quotes, oversee agreements and make sure renovations and repairs are performed by qualified contractors to a high professional standard.
- You will be required to drive between buildings and to our head office. You will also be required to pick up supplies etc. as needed.
- Work with and assist the President / Owner to renovate, develop and/or manage real estate projects.
